반응형
Lombok 버전 : 1.16.22
스프링 Boot 프로젝트 배포를 위해 Maven Build 를 수행하던 중 Lombok 어노테이션을 적용해둔 도메인 클래스에서 컴파일 오류가 발생했다.
구글링 해본 결과 @Data와 @NoArgsConstructor를 같이 쓸 때 발생하는 버그로 지금은 fix된듯 하다.
https://github.com/rzwitserloot/lombok/issues/1703
Lombok 버전을 변경하거나 @NoArgsContsructor를 먼저 선언해주는 방법으로 컴파일 오류 없이 컴파일 할 수 있었다.
@NoArgsConstructor
@Data
public class SomeDomain {
....
}
반응형
'Back-End > Java' 카테고리의 다른 글
Java에서 파일의 Mime type을 판별하는 방법 (0) | 2020.11.04 |
---|---|
JUnit5 사용해보기 (0) | 2020.02.01 |
자바 동일성, 동등성 차이 (0) | 2018.11.24 |
Java NIO란 (0) | 2018.10.02 |
Java Stream API 소개 (0) | 2018.09.17 |